How Much Are Moon Shoes Worth?

Moon shoes, a fascinating twist on childhood nostalgia, have recently captured the attention of collectors and enthusiasts alike. Originally created in the 1990s, these unique bouncy footwear items were marketed as a fun way to experience a sort of lunar bounce, reminiscent of how astronauts moved on the Moon’s surface. The playful design, featuring a strap-on mechanism and a wide platform, made them not only eye-catching but also a blast to wear, especially on paved surfaces. However, as time has passed and the years rolled on, moon shoes have become more than just the fun of the past; they have evolved into a curious collector’s item, raising the question of their market value in today’s purchasing climate.

Determining how much moon shoes are worth today can be both intriguing and elusive. Various factors come into play, primarily the condition of the shoes, their rarity, and the demand generated by collectors and enthusiasts. A new or gently used pair, especially those that come complete with their original packaging or promotional materials, can see their value skyrocket. There have been reports of certain pairs fetching several hundred dollars on auction sites. Conversely, well-worn shoes, which show signs of age or use, typically command lower prices, often settling in the range of $50 to $150.

The rarity factor significantly influences the moon shoes’ worth. Some collectors actively seek out limited edition or unique versions of these shoes. If you happen to stumble upon a particular model that was produced in small quantities or as part of a promotional event, you might find yourself holding a gem that could be valued much higher than typical market pricing suggests. In some cases, select pairs have been known to sell for over $1,000, especially if they were tied to memorable advertising campaigns or celebrity endorsements at the time of their release.

Taking into account the online resale market, platforms like eBay have opened vast avenues for selling collectibles like moon shoes. On these platforms, you can easily find listings that range anywhere from $25 for heavily used models to more than $800 for those that are in mint condition or include the original box. The fluctuation in asking prices often reflects not only the state of the shoes but also the urgency of the seller and the current trends in collectors’ interests. Recent spikes in nostalgia for 90s toys and collectibles further drive this market, leading many to believe that the value of such items may continue to rise as new generations discover them.

Condition remains the most significant factor when evaluating old pairs of moon shoes. If you find a pair that has kept its original sparkle, with no significant scuffs or interior wear, you may be sitting on a treasure trove. Collectors often prefer unblemished pairs that are suitable for display but would also appreciate gently used versions that they can wear. Sellers should be transparent about any flaws or modifications to the shoes, as authenticity is paramount in the collectible market.
